Starting on Ash Wednesday (14 February), Christians will gather in Central London outside the Houses of Parliament for the first 10 days of Lent as part of a 24/7 prayer vigil for climate justice. We will pray for creation, for our global neighbours, for our government and for change.

COP28 comes at a crucial moment as scientists say the world must reduce emissions by 42% by 2030 to avoid the most severe impacts of global heating. However, emissions are still going up, with fossil fuel companies planning to increase production. And according to a report out this month from the International Energy Agency, last year fossil fuel companies were responsible for a minuscule 1% of global investment in renewable energy.
